Water pressure repair services focus on diagnosing and fixing issues related to inconsistent or insufficient water flow within a plumbing system. These services typically involve inspecting pipes, fittings, and valves to identify leaks, blockages, or damaged components that may be causing pressure problems. Technicians may perform repairs or replacements to restore optimal water flow, ensuring that fixtures such as faucets, showers, and appliances operate efficiently. Addressing water pressure issues promptly can help prevent further damage and improve the overall functionality of a property's plumbing system.
Problems that water pressure repair services help resolve include low water pressure, which can make daily tasks like washing dishes or taking showers frustrating, and sudden pressure surges that can damage fixtures or cause leaks. These services also address issues like fluctuating pressure or complete loss of water flow, which may result from pipe corrosion, clogs, or faulty pressure regulators. Timely repairs can prevent more extensive plumbing failures, reduce water waste, and enhance the comfort and usability of residential, commercial, or industrial properties.
Properties that commonly require water pressure repair services include single-family homes, apartment complexes, office buildings, and retail establishments. Residential properties often experience pressure issues due to aging pipes or sediment buildup, while larger commercial properties may encounter pressure fluctuations caused by complex plumbing networks or high demand. Industrial facilities with specialized equipment may also need consistent water pressure to maintain operations. Regardless of property size or type, maintaining proper water pressure is essential for efficient water use and the longevity of plumbing infrastructure.

Cost Range for Water Pressure Repair - Typical costs for water pressure repair services can vary between $150 and $500, depending on the extent of the issue and the necessary repairs. For example, minor fixes may be closer to $150, while more extensive repairs could approach $500.
Factors Influencing Pricing - The total cost often depends on factors such as the complexity of the repair and local labor rates. In Monroe, WA, repairs might cost more or less within the general range based on specific circumstances.
Average Service Charges - On average, homeowners might expect to pay around $200 to $350 for water pressure repair services. This includes diagnostic work, parts, and labor, with prices fluctuating by project scope.
Additional Costs to Consider - Additional expenses may include replacement parts or additional repairs if the issue is extensive. Local service providers will provide detailed estimates based on the specific repair need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es low water pressure in a home? Low water pressure can result from issues such as clogged pipes, leaks, or problems with the main water supply. A local water pressure repair professional can diagnose and address these causes.
How can water pressure be improved? Water pressure can often be increased by repairing or replacing faulty valves, clearing blockages, or fixing leaks. Contact a local service provider for assessment and solutions.
Is water pressure repair necessary for plumbing system health? Yes, maintaining proper water pressure helps prevent pipe damage and ensures efficient water flow. A professional can determine if repairs are needed.
What signs indicate a water pressure issue? Signs include inconsistent flow, reduced water flow from fixtures, or unusual noises in pipes. A local expert can evaluate and recommend repairs.
